Method: selection.v1.projects.selectedRoutes.batchCreate

چندین SelectedRoutes ایجاد می کند و برنامه ای را برای بازیابی دوره ای اطلاعات حافظه پنهان برای هر یک از مسیرها شروع می کند.

درخواست HTTP

POST https://roads.googleapis.com/selection/v1/{parent=projects/*}/selectedRoutes:batchCreate

URL از دستور GRPC Transcoding استفاده می کند.

پارامترهای مسیر

پارامترها
parent

string

اختیاری. منبع پروژه به اشتراک گذاشته شده توسط همه مسیرهای انتخاب شده. قالب: پروژه‌ها/{پروژه} اگر این تنظیم شده باشد، فیلد والد در پیام‌های CreateSelectedRouteRequest باید یا خالی باشد یا با این فیلد مطابقت داشته باشد.

درخواست بدن

بدنه درخواست حاوی داده هایی با ساختار زیر است:

نمایندگی JSON
{
  "requests": [
    {
      object (CreateSelectedRouteRequest)
    }
  ]
}
فیلدها
requests[]

object ( CreateSelectedRouteRequest )

مورد نیاز. پیام درخواست مسیر انتخاب شده برای ایجاد را مشخص می کند. حداکثر 1000 مسیر انتخابی را می توان در یک دسته ایجاد کرد.

بدن پاسخگو

پاسخ از ایجاد چندین SelectedRoute s.

در صورت موفقیت آمیز بودن، بدنه پاسخ حاوی داده هایی با ساختار زیر است:

نمایندگی JSON
{
  "selectedRoutes": [
    {
      object (SelectedRoute)
    }
  ]
}
فیلدها
selectedRoutes[]

object ( SelectedRoute )

SelectedRoutes ایجاد شد.

محدوده مجوز

به محدوده OAuth زیر نیاز دارد:

  • https://www.googleapis.com/auth/cloud-platform

CreateSelectedRouteRequest

درخواست ایجاد یک SelectedRoute .

نمایندگی JSON
{
  "parent": string,
  "selectedRoute": {
    object (SelectedRoute)
  },
  "selectedRouteId": string
}
فیلدها
parent

string

مورد نیاز. پروژه ای که SelectedRoute تحت آن ایجاد خواهد شد. قالب: پروژه ها/{پروژه}

selectedRoute

object ( SelectedRoute )

مورد نیاز. SelectedRoute برای ایجاد.

selectedRouteId

string

اختیاری. شناسه مورد استفاده برای SelectedRoute ، که جزء نهایی نام منبع SelectedRoute خواهد بود.

این مقدار باید 4-63 کاراکتر باشد و کاراکترهای معتبر عبارتند از: "az"، "AZ"، "0-9" یا "-". اگر ارائه نشده یا خالی باشد، پس از ایجاد منبع، یک UUID ایجاد خواهد شد.